ARM架构安装ubuntu系统

简介: 8月更文挑战第19天

在ARM架构(如树莓派、嵌入式设备等)上安装Ubuntu系统,通常需要一个SD卡作为介质,并且可能需要使用特殊的工具(如Etcher、balenaEtcher等)来写入系统镜像。以下是一个基本的步骤概述:

  1. 下载Ubuntu镜像:
    • 访问Ubuntu官方网站(​​https://www.ubuntu.com/)下载适用于ARM架构的Ubuntu镜像。通常选择"Desktop"版或"Server"版,取决于你的需求。​​
  2. 写入SD卡:
    • 使用一个适合ARM的镜像写入工具,如Etcher(​​https://www.balena.io/etcher/)或Win32DiskImager(Windows用户)。​​
    • 打开工具,选择下载的Ubuntu镜像文件,然后选择你的SD卡作为目标设备,开始写入。
  3. 设置启动顺序:
    • 在大多数ARM设备上,你需要在BIOS设置中更改启动顺序,确保从SD卡启动。
  4. 引导安装:
    • 插入SD卡并重启设备,进入启动菜单选择“Try Ubuntu without installing”进行试用,确认没有问题后继续安装。
  5. 安装Ubuntu:
    • 试用阶段结束,选择“Install Ubuntu”开始安装过程。按照屏幕提示操作,包括选择语言、地区、键盘布局,创建一个新的用户账户等。
  6. 分区和格式化:
    • 根据需要,选择“Guided – Use entire disk”或手动分区。如果你的设备有足够的空间,一般会建议你创建一个交换分区以提高系统稳定性。
  7. 安装过程:
    • 完成分区后,点击“Install Now”,等待安装完成。这可能需要一段时间,取决于你的硬件性能和SD卡的速度。
  8. 启动和配置:
    • 安装完成后,首次启动时可能会让你选择启动方式,确保选择从SD卡启动。接下来,按照提示完成系统设置,如网络配置、时区设置等。
  9. 升级和优化:
    • 安装完成后,首次启动时会自动进行软件更新。根据设备性能,你可能还需要安装一些驱动程序和优化工具,如无线网卡驱动、声卡驱动等。
    请注意,不同设备的具体步骤可能会有所不同,特别是对于更复杂的嵌入式设备,可能需要额外的配置和引导加载器设置。在进行此类操作之前,请确保备份重要数据,以防意外
相关文章
|
5月前
|
SQL 前端开发 关系型数据库
如何开发一套研发项目管理系统?(附架构图+流程图+代码参考)
研发项目管理系统助力企业实现需求、缺陷与变更的全流程管理,支持看板可视化、数据化决策与成本优化。系统以MVP模式快速上线,核心功能包括需求看板、缺陷闭环、自动日报及关键指标分析,助力中小企业提升交付效率与协作质量。
|
4月前
|
数据采集 机器学习/深度学习 运维
量化合约系统开发架构入门
量化合约系统核心在于数据、策略、风控与执行四大模块的协同,构建从数据到决策再到执行的闭环工作流。强调可追溯、可复现与可观测性,避免常见误区如重回测轻验证、忽视数据质量或滞后风控。初学者应以MVP为起点,结合回测框架与实时风控实践,逐步迭代。详见相关入门与实战资料。
|
4月前
|
前端开发 JavaScript BI
如何开发车辆管理系统中的车务管理板块(附架构图+流程图+代码参考)
本文介绍了中小企业如何通过车务管理模块提升车辆管理效率。许多企业在管理车辆时仍依赖人工流程,导致违章处理延误、年检过期、维修费用虚高等问题频发。将这些流程数字化,可显著降低合规风险、提升维修追溯性、优化调度与资产利用率。文章详细介绍了车务管理模块的功能清单、数据模型、系统架构、API与前端设计、开发技巧与落地建议,以及实现效果与验收标准。同时提供了数据库建表SQL、后端Node.js/TypeScript代码示例与前端React表单设计参考,帮助企业快速搭建并上线系统,实现合规与成本控制的双重优化。
|
5月前
|
数据采集 运维 数据可视化
AR 运维系统与 MES、EMA、IoT 系统的融合架构与实践
AR运维系统融合IoT、EMA、MES数据,构建“感知-分析-决策-执行”闭环。通过AR终端实现设备数据可视化,实时呈现温度、工单等信息,提升运维效率与生产可靠性。(238字)
|
5月前
|
人工智能 监控 测试技术
告别只会写提示词:构建生产级LLM系统的完整架构图​
本文系统梳理了从提示词到生产级LLM产品的八大核心能力:提示词工程、上下文工程、微调、RAG、智能体开发、部署、优化与可观测性,助你构建可落地、可迭代的AI产品体系。
764 52
|
4月前
|
Ubuntu 安全 iOS开发
Nessus Professional 10.10 Auto Installer for Ubuntu 24.04 - Nessus 自动化安装程序
Nessus Professional 10.10 Auto Installer for Ubuntu 24.04 - Nessus 自动化安装程序
302 5
|
4月前
|
Ubuntu 编译器 开发工具
在Ubuntu系统上搭建RISC-V交叉编译环境
以上步骤涵盖了在Ubuntu系统上搭建RISC-V交叉编译环境的主要过程。这一过程涉及了安装依赖、克隆源码、编译安装工具链以及设置环境变量等关键步骤。遵循这些步骤,可以在Ubuntu系统上搭建一个用于RISC-V开发的强大工具集。
495 22
|
4月前
|
Ubuntu 网络协议 网络安全
解决Ubuntu系统的网络连接问题
以上步骤通常可以帮助解决大多数Ubuntu系统的网络连接问题。如果问题仍然存在,可能需要更深入的诊断,或考虑联系网络管理员或专业技术人员。
1009 18
|
4月前
|
NoSQL Ubuntu MongoDB
在Ubuntu 22.04上安装MongoDB 6.0的步骤
这些步骤应该可以在Ubuntu 22.04系统上安装MongoDB 6.0。安装过程中,如果遇到任何问题,可以查阅MongoDB的官方文档或者Ubuntu的相关帮助文档,这些资源通常提供了解决特定问题的详细指导。
466 18
|
4月前
|
机器学习/深度学习 人工智能 缓存
面向边缘通用智能的多大语言模型系统:架构、信任与编排——论文阅读
本文提出面向边缘通用智能的多大语言模型(Multi-LLM)系统,通过协同架构、信任机制与动态编排,突破传统边缘AI的局限。融合合作、竞争与集成三种范式,结合模型压缩、分布式推理与上下文优化技术,实现高效、可靠、低延迟的边缘智能,推动复杂场景下的泛化与自主决策能力。
405 3
面向边缘通用智能的多大语言模型系统:架构、信任与编排——论文阅读